Degree program cuts are more tragic than Lobo Lucy incident

Editor,

On the front page of Monday’s Daily Lobo, there was a story about the mascot Lobo Lucy being allegedly groped by a drunken fan.

The incident is sad, but I don’t see why that story gets to be the biggest front page article with a giant photo while the article about degree programs being chopped, not to mention the many other things the administration has taken away to balance the budget, is slowly pasted below that article.

Now tell me, which affects me more: Someone possibly groping a mascot or the fact that the chemistry and math departments have lost more than 25 professors this year?

Oh sure, I’ll feel bad for Lucy while I’m sitting in my class of 100 or 200 students taught by an undergraduate who could not teach himself out of a paper bag.

I’ll remember her when I’m recording my speech for public speaking at home because there won’t be anymore classes to take on campus, yet head football coach Mike Locksley will continue working on a million-dollar contract because he’s been so good these past few years. Please get your priorities straight.

Abraham Sammy
UNM student
